Telecom Field Operations Fiber Technician
JOB SUMMARY:
The Telecom Field Operations Fiber Technician is responsible for project and operational support of Southern Company’s outside plant (OSP) and campus fiber infrastructure. This role supports critical optical transport systems, including DWDM, GPON, MPLS, SEL-ICON, and SCADA networks. Work is performed in accordance with established standards, service-level expectations, operational procedures, and applicable work agreements to ensure safe, consistent, and high-quality service delivery.

Technical Competencies
Proficient in single/ribbon splicing and terminating single-mode and multi-mode fiber optic cables
Proficient in reading, testing, and documenting using an Optical Time-Domain Reflectometer (OTDR)
Fundamental understanding of CD (Chromatic Dispersion) and PMD (Polarization Mode Dispersion) and bi-directional fiber optic testing is preferred
Experience with Optical Ground Wire (OPGW) fiber cable of various types. (e.g., stainless steel tube, tight buffer tube, star, etc.) is preferred
Experience with All-Dielectric Self-Supporting (ADSS) and other aerial fiber optic cables
Experience documenting fiber optic route information (traces, power levels, splice points, etc.)
Experience installing and maintaining ancillary equipment (alarm systems, DC/AC power systems, etc.) is preferred
